MOTION NO. 11
MOTION: Councillor W. Carey
That this Area Committee agrees that SDCC should secure the gaps in railings which secures Monastery gate Villas green space and the Shalimar Apartments/Ibis Hotel lands. This area is becoming a source of anti social activity and drug dealing and requires a higher level of maintenance to keep secure.
REPORT:
The boundary fence between the open space at Monastery Gate Villas and Shalimar Apartments/Ibis Hotel has not been taken in charge. The maintenance and upkeep of this boundary is a matter for the landowner. The boundary has been inspected and there are no gaps in the Shalimar Apartments section. There are 2 gaps in the Ibis Hotel section which lead into the car park. One gap has been created where bars have been prised apart and the second gap is the result of a bar being removed. There is evidence that repairs have been carried out to other sections of the boundary in the past.
The Ibis Hotel will be contacted and requested to secure the gaps in the boundary fence.
